YOUR MISSION

True Anomaly is looking for a creative Senior Thermal Engineer to develop new spacecraft. In this role you will be work with a multi-disciplinary product team to rapidly develop and produce new space systems. 

R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Work with a product focused team including mechanical, electrical, software, and automation engineers to rapidly develop revolutionary thermal designs 
  • Perform integrated thermal analysis to determine heater/radiator sizing and external coatings required to maintain all elements of the SV in thermal limits 
  • Perform thermal detailed analysis over variety of design reference missions (DRM’s) 
  • Design and help develop detail piece part and assembly drawings for heaters, MLI, and other thermal control components 
  • Assist with electronic thermal predictions and board level analysis 
  • Coordinate thermal interfaces between subsystems 
  • Support Thermal Vacuum and Thermal Cycle testing 
  • Support on orbit operations 

QUALIFICATIONS

  • Bachelor’s degree in mechanical engineering with training in analysis of structures and fluids 
  • 6+ years of professional experience in space thermal analysis and control 
  • Demonstrated excellence in thermal vacuum testing, analysis and model correlation 
  • Thermal experience with spacecraft subcomponents such as optical payloads, mechanisms, structures, etc.  
  • Proficiency in tools such as Thermal Desktop and Solidworks 
  • Passion for the space industry 
  • Demonstrated ability to work in a multidisciplinary team 
  • Demonstrated ability to work autonomously with little input on requirements or management oversight 
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
